Crispy Oatmeal Apple Crisp with a Warm, Juicy Cinnamon Filling

Prep Time 20 minutes
Cook Time 1 hour
Total Time 1 hour 20 minutes
Servings 10
Calories 304kcal

Ingredients

  • 5-6 medium apples peeled and cut into ½ inch chunks (8 cups)
  • ½ cup brown sugar
  • 1 ½ teaspoons cinnamon
  • ½ teaspoon nutmeg
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la
  • 1 tablespoon apple brandy optional

Topping

  • ¾ cup flour
  • ¾ cup brown sugar
  • 1 teaspoon cinnamon
  • ½ cup butter cold and cut into ½ inch cubes
  • 1 cup old-fashioned rolled oats

Instructions

  • Preheat the oven to 350º.
  • Add the chopped apples to a large bowl. Add brown sugar, cinnamon, nutmeg, vanilla and apple brandy if using. Stir to combine and pour into a 9 x 13 inch baking dish.
  • In a medium bowl, whisk together the flour, brown sugar and cinnamon. Add cold butter cubes and use a pastry cutter or fork to incorporate it into the dry ingredients. Once combined, add the oatmeal and sprinkle over the apples.
  • Bake for 1 hour until the apples are fork tender, and it is bubbling around the edges.

Notes

  • Try using a mixture of apples for a more complex flavor.
  • The baking time will vary depending on the type of apple. They should be fork tender before removing from the oven.
